Transaction 679934a8ba244b9b41b86e177004d1d0abeaafc41a6ff1977ede9b418be753d2

26 Input
2 Outputs
  • 679934a8ba244b9b41b86e177004d1d0abeaafc41a6ff1977ede9b418be753d2:0
  • value  1000078
    address  1GFJDFYWL5jV3in2agnnMnFKRtLEpHhWGh
  • 679934a8ba244b9b41b86e177004d1d0abeaafc41a6ff1977ede9b418be753d2:1
  • value  1161591016
    address  1CtWfqgzEZdNVKLjRoTajb1F3xFqBG2nq4